## 2.9.0 — Defaults changed: Relayquill circuit breaker

Breaker on the upstream Quotewise API now trips after 5 consecutive failures (was 12). Half-open probe interval cut to 15s. Timeout budget tightened to 2s per call. Expect faster failover, more frequent short trips during Quotewise maintenance windows. No action needed unless you overrode defaults. New values shipped are as follows.

service settings:
PRAIX_LOG_LEVEL=error
PRAIX_METRICS_HOST=metrics.praix.qorvelcorp.corp
PRAIX_POOL_SIZE=16

## Step 4: Reduce GC pauses in Pairwell Match

The old matcher allocated a candidate graph per request, triggering full GC pauses over 800ms at peak. The new build pools graph buffers and pins the young-gen size. Set heap flags per the deploy template before restarting. Verify pause times in the gc-stats dashboard stay under 50ms for ten minutes. Then re-point the matcher at the scoring database so pooled workers can warm their caches. Use the connection string below.

replica DSN, yahog-kawig: redis://istox_svc:um@db-8a67.halixforge.test:5432/frawyn

**Q: Where do I sign visitors in now that reception has moved?**

A: Reception is now on the ground floor of Tollgate House, beside the east stairwell. The old second-floor desk is closed permanently. Night shift should direct all arrivals to the ground-floor desk; after 22:00 it is unstaffed, and entry through the inner doors requires the code below.

staff pass of kagup-fajog = bdg-QCHVQW-99665837

## Onboarding — Markdown Pipeline (Inkmere)

Inkmere docs render through a three-stage pipeline: parse, sanitize, emit. Releases rebuild all templates; never hot-patch emitted HTML. Broken renders usually mean a sanitizer rule change — check the rules diff first. The render cluster only accepts builds from the release channel, and every build artifact must be signed before upload. Sign artifacts with the deploy key below.

release key, hafop-tajef: bky13_s2vaFVNJTHfBL